Indoor temperatures in buildings of the future will automatically adjust to user needs

Thursday, April 13, 2017 - 06:51 in Physics & Chemistry

The HumanTool project being led by VTT Technical Research Centre of Finland involves the testing of new indoor temperature control concepts for adjusting spaces to individual needs. Energy is saved when unused rooms can be left unheated or uncooled. The final result of the project will be a completely new product.
